Veranda removal services involve carefully dismantling and removing existing outdoor structures that extend from a home's main building. These structures can include open or enclosed porches, decks, or covered patios that are no longer desired or need replacement. Skilled service providers handle the entire process, ensuring that the removal is done safely and efficiently, with attention to protecting the surrounding property and landscaping. This service is ideal for homeowners who want to update their outdoor spaces, eliminate damaged or outdated verandas, or prepare their property for new construction or landscaping projects.

Removing an existing veranda can help resolve several common problems faced by homeowners. Over time, verandas can suffer from weather damage, rot, or structural issues that compromise safety or aesthetic appeal. In some cases, a veranda may no longer suit the homeowner’s lifestyle or design preferences. Removing the structure clears the way for renovations, new additions, or simply to improve the appearance of the property. Professional removal services ensure that the process minimizes disruption, avoids damage to the home or yard, and prepares the area for any future outdoor upgrades.

The overview below groups typical Veranda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Evergreen,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or veranda removal projects,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ering tasks like removing a small, lightweight structure.

Partial Removal - When only part of a veranda needs to be taken down, costs generally range from $600 to $1,500. Larger, more involved partial removals are less common but can reach higher prices depending on scope.

Full Replacement - Complete veranda removal and replacement projects often cost between $2,000 and $5,000. Many full replacements fall into this range, though more complex projects can exceed $5,000.

Larger, Complex Projects - Extensive veranda removals involving structural work or custom features can surpass $5,000, with some high-end projects reaching $10,000 or more depending on the details and materials involved.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in veranda removal services? Veranda removal services typically include the careful dismantling and disposal of existing porch structures, including framing, decking, railings, and supports, to prepare for renovation or new construction.

How do local contractors handle veranda removal safely? Local service providers follow established safety procedures, including proper equipment use and site management, to ensure the removal process minimizes risks and damage to surrounding areas.

Can veranda removal be coordinated with other home improvement projects? Yes, many contractors can coordinate veranda removal with other projects such as deck replacement, patio installation, or home renovations for a seamless upgrade process.

What types of verandas are typically removed by service providers? Service providers commonly remove various veranda styles, including wood, composite, or vinyl structures, regardless of size or complexity.

How do local pros dispose of old veranda materials? They typically handle the removal and proper disposal or recycling of old materials, ensuring environmentally responsible waste management according to local regulations.
